Additional positive mid-year reports have poured in link recently from the Swatch Group, Richemont, and LVMH – the Swiss watch industry's trio of publicly traded behemoths. The world's largest dedicated watch company, the Swatch Group, saw a first-half growth of 7.4 percent compared to last year. Richemont's Specialist Watchmakers division (which does not include Cartier, Van Cleef & Arpels, or Montblanc) grew 10 percent year-to-year, passing the one-billion euro** mark from January to June 2022.
